7 year old (who usually wears a medium top and 8H bottoms) wears a size 11/12 and could probably use a size 13/14 for more instep freedom but legs are probably too long. I cut out the mesh lining because it went up and the instep was too short. My son has complained that the lining is uncomfortable and the suit slides down to reveal a tear! Removing the liner greatly improved the fit and now he loves it. So I would buy them again and remove the lining because I don't like the oversized baggy swimsuits for boys that are currently on the market and I don't like the tight jammers. After a lot of searching over the years this is the best we have found which is why they get 4 stars. We have a navy blue tiki style and we love this color. He wore a ton of it with very little fading/pilling.
